Releases: qiboteam/qibojit
Releases · qiboteam/qibojit
qibojit 0.1.8
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#194
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#197
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#198
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#201
- Fixes for GPU tests and GPU workflow by @BrunoLiegiBastonLiegi in #200
- Compatibility with CuQuantum>=23.10 by @andrea-pasquale in #202
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#204
- Cupy matrices by @BrunoLiegiBastonLiegi in #199
- Generate selfhosted tests in separared folder by @andrea-pasquale in #208
- Option to run only gpu tests in conftest by @BrunoLiegiBastonLiegi in #206
- Move tests outside src by @andrea-pasquale in #209
I()
for cupy matrices by @BrunoLiegiBastonLiegi in #207
Full Changelog: v0.1.7...v0.1.8
qibojit 0.1.7
What's Changed
- Fix bug in
quantum_info.linalg_operations.matrix_power
for negative powers of singular matrices (#192) @renatomello
What's Changed
- Fix bug in
quantum_info.linalg_operations.matrix_power
for negative powers of singular matrices by @renatomello in #192 - [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#193
Full Changelog: v0.1.6...v0.1.7
qibojit 0.1.6
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#187
- Add
gates.GeneralizedRBS
gate by @renatomello in #183 - Add
calculate_matrix_power
to backends by @renatomello in #189 - Add
hermitian
argument tocalculate_eigenvalues
andcalculate_eigenvectors
by @renatomello in #188 - Bugfix to matrix unpacking for
CliffordBackend
by @BrunoLiegiBastonLiegi in #190
Full Changelog: v0.1.5...v0.1.6
qibojit 0.1.5
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#182
- Switch reusable workflows to v1, instead of main by @alecandido in #184
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#186
- Rename
backend.issparse
asbackend.is_sparse
by @renatomello in #185
Full Changelog: v0.1.4...v0.1.5
qibojit 0.1.4
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#174
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#176
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#177
- Support Python 3.12 by @alecandido in #170
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#178
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#180
CliffordBackend
with packed bits by @BrunoLiegiBastonLiegi in #173- Add
CCZ
gate by @renatomello in #175 - MetaBackend by @BrunoLiegiBastonLiegi in #172
- Adding
cupy
exponentiation method by @andrea-pasquale in #179
Full Changelog: v0.1.3...v0.1.4
qibojit 0.1.3
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#160
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#162
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#163
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#164
- Add SXDG gate by @Simone-Bordoni in #168
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#167
- Nix by @alecandido in #169
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#171
- Parallelization of
CliffordOperations
throughnumba
andcupy
by @BrunoLiegiBastonLiegi in #161
New Contributors
- @Simone-Bordoni made their first contribution in #168
Full Changelog: v0.1.2...v0.1.3
qibojit 0.1.2
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#157
- removing py38 by @scarrazza in #159
- Create
gates.CY
by @renatomello in #158
Full Changelog: v0.1.1...v0.1.2
qibojit 0.1.1
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#139
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#141
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#142
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#143
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#145
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#147
- Bump pillow from 10.0.0 to 10.0.1 by @dependabot in #146
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#148
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#149
- Nix shell by @alecandido in #150
- Circuit Execution Outputs by @BrunoLiegiBastonLiegi in #153
New Contributors
- @dependabot made their first contribution in #146
- @alecandido made their first contribution in #150
- @BrunoLiegiBastonLiegi made their first contribution in #153
Full Changelog: v0.1.0...v0.1.1
qibojit 0.1.0
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#134
- adding build system by @scarrazza in #135
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#136
- Change
.matrix
from property to method and removeasmatrix
method by @renatomello in #137
Full Changelog: v0.0.12...v0.1.0
qibojit 0.0.12
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#126
- Generalize
ReadoutErrorChannel
implementation for any non-unitaryKrausChannel
by @renatomello in #129 - Implementation of
CSX
andDEUTSCH
gates by @renatomello in #127 - adding readme by @scarrazza in #132
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#133
- Update
qibo
dependency by @renatomello in #130
Full Changelog: v0.0.11...v0.0.12